May 2, 2026: Cornerstone Lakes Event #157–A chilly morning, with clear skies and minimal wind. Great parkrun weather! Our new sandhill crane friend was not phased as participants ran/walked right past him.

12 finishers and six volunteers made it out the door an hour earlier for our first 8 AM start of the spring/summer parkrun season. We welcomed tourists Sarah (from Australia) and Victor and Paula (from Florida). Sarah celebrated her 50th milestone. Congratulations! Kacy (and Krai) achieved a PB!

The remainder of the 5K crew consisted of Cornerstone Lakes regulars Jaeseok, Andrew, Andy, Alissa, Colin, Orlando, Dave, and Kristen. Jaeseok landed his first 1st place finish of 2026!

A special thanks to our volunteers, Brian, Al, Kristen, Lucy, Tamara, and Colin. Tamara was a first time volunteer, and hope to see her back again one day soon! We have timekeeper, barcode scanning, finisher tokens, and equipment storage/delivery available next weekend. Please let us know if you can help. Don’t forget that we’ve switched to an 8 AM start time.
